When to send it

  1. Day 0
    Log every call, time, and what was said, including any threats.
  2. Day 1
    Send a cease-contact or dispute letter citing FDCPA §1692d and §1692c.
  3. After the letter
    The collector may only contact you to confirm receipt or state further action.
  4. If it continues
    File a CFPB complaint and consider a private FDCPA lawsuit for statutory damages.

Can a debt collector call me at work or repeatedly?

FDCPA §1692d bars conduct meant to harass, oppress, or abuse, including repeated calls intended to annoy, and §1692c restricts workplace calls once you object.

How much can I recover for violations?

The FDCPA allows actual damages plus up to $1,000 in statutory damages per lawsuit, plus attorney's fees.
